WEC Predictions
The top three fights on the WEC pay-per-view card tonight should be excellent. Here are my predictions:
Mike Brown Vs. Manny Gamburyan. Both of these fighters come in with just five losses. The difference is that Brown has 23 wins compared to Gamburyan’s 12 wins. Brown shocked the world when he upset Faber to win the title. I don’t think the world will be as shocked when he defeats Gamburyan tonight.
Prediction: Brown by TKO.
Ben Henderson Vs. Donald Cerrone. This could be the fight of the night. Both of these guys are tough. They fought before and Henderson came away with a unanimous decision. There’s an old saying that past performance is the best predictor of future performance.
Prediction: Henderson by Decision.
Jose Aldo Vs. Urijah Faber. The title is on the line. Just a couple of years ago Faber was unstoppable. Then he was upset by Mike Brown, who was in turn TKO’d by Jose Aldo. Almost everyone see Aldo winning by TKO or KO. One thing I’ve learned is that the race doesn’t always go to the biggest or fastest dog, but that’s the way to bet.
Prediction: Aldo by TKO.
